Frequently Asked Questions
How many Wh is 3,070,601 mAh?
3,070,601 mAh equals 11,361.2237 Wh at 3.7V (Li-ion nominal voltage). The exact Wh depends on the battery voltage: Wh = mAh × V / 1,000.
How do I convert 3,070,601 mAh to Wh?
Multiply 3,070,601 by the battery voltage, then divide by 1,000. At 3.7V: 3,070,601 × 3.7 / 1,000 = 11,361.2237 Wh.
Is 3,070,601 mAh allowed on a plane?
At 3.7V, 3,070,601 mAh = 11,361.2237 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
